Protesters organize sit-in at Abdel Hamid square in Tripoli

Abdul Hamid Karami square in the center of Tripoli witnessed a sit-in during which participants burned political slogans that had been raised earlier in the square, as well as setting fire to a number of tires. Statements by protesters were made condemning the current economic crisis.

Residents block Ansar-Doueir road in protest of Bsawfar landfill

A number of residents of Ansar staged a sit-in on the highway of Ansar - Dueir at the invitation of Ansar Organization in the Lebanese Communist Party, in protest against the ministerial decision to re-open the Bsawfar landfill, which has been closed for obver 20 years. 

Nabatieh-Habbouche road blocked by protesters

Protesters deliberately nlocked the Nabatieh - Habbouche highway to protest against the deterioration of the economic situation, and burned tires in the middle of the road causing traffic congestion.

 

Protesters block Baalbeck road over bad economy

A few dozen people briefly blocked a main road in Baalbeck Sunday morning, protesting the deteriorating economic situation.The protesters blocked the road with a number of vans parked horizontally across it, preventing cars from passing by. It was reopened shortly after by security forces.

Farmers block Baalbek-Homs road in protest to crops seizure

Farmers and pick-up owners cut off the international road in Baalbek-Homs at the entrance to Hermel in Mahatta locality, near the army checkpoint, in protest at what they called "the Lebanese army's seizure of Lebanese crops under the pretext of smuggling". Most recently is the seizure of about 20 pick-up trucks at the Assi checkpoint in Hermel, loaded with eggplants and peppers. 

Palestinians sit-in in front of UNRWA’s headquarters

Residents of the Palestinian camps and gatherings in Beirut, Sidon and Tyre held a sit-in in front of UNRWA headquarters, in response to a call made by the PLO's Refugee Affairs Department and the Popular Committees in Lebanon, calling on the international community for continuous support to the UN Relief and Works Agency.

Protesters block Laboueh - Nabi Osmane road with burning tires

 The international road of Baalbek-Homs in the northern Bekaa was cut off in Laboueh and Nabi Osmane districts with burning tires by protesters due to the deteriorating economic situation

Gas station owners decide on an open ended strike

The head of the Syndicate of Gas Stations Owners in Lebanon, Sami Brax, communicated that the occurence of an open-ended strike, as agreed upon by the majority of gas station owners, until an agreement with officials has been reached in terms of their demands. 

Support amid threats for Mashrou’ Leila

Around 150 people gathered in Beirut’s Samir Kassir Square Monday to show their support for local band Mashrou’ Leila in light of mounting pressure by Lebanese Christian groups to cancel an upcoming concert.
